Skip to content

Commit 9d12aaa

Browse files
authored
build: fix up naming for Stackblitz (#31312)
Removes the dashes from the Stackblitz name in the docs site so it's closer to how it's named on stackblitz.com.
1 parent 8cb522d commit 9d12aaa

21 files changed

+14
-14
lines changed

docs/firebase.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-76,7 +76,7 @@
7676
]
7777
},
7878
{
79-
"source": "/assets/stack-blitz/**",
79+
"source": "/assets/stackblitz/**",
8080
"headers": [
8181
{
8282
"key": "Cache-Control",

docs/src/app/shared/example-viewer/example-viewer.html

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-56,7 +56,7 @@
5656
<mat-icon>code</mat-icon>
5757
</button>
5858

59-
<stack-blitz-button [example]="example"></stack-blitz-button>
59+
<stackblitz-button [example]="example"></stackblitz-button>
6060
</div>
6161

6262
@if (view === 'full') {

docs/src/app/shared/example-viewer/example-viewer.ts

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,7 @@ import {type LiveExample, loadExample} from '@angular/components-examples';
1414
import {CodeSnippet} from './code-snippet';
1515
import {normalizePath} from '../normalize-path';
1616
import {MatTab, MatTabGroup} from '@angular/material/tabs';
17-
import {StackBlitzButton} from '../stack-blitz/stack-blitz-button';
17+
import {StackblitzButton} from '../stackblitz/stackblitz-button';
1818
import {MatIcon} from '@angular/material/icon';
1919
import {MatTooltip} from '@angular/material/tooltip';
2020
import {MatIconButton} from '@angular/material/button';
@@ -37,7 +37,7 @@ const preferredExampleFileOrder = ['HTML', 'TS', 'CSS'];
3737
MatIconButton,
3838
MatTooltip,
3939
MatIcon,
40-
StackBlitzButton,
40+
StackblitzButton,
4141
MatTabGroup,
4242
MatTab,
4343
CodeSnippet,

docs/src/app/shared/stack-blitz/index.ts renamed to docs/src/app/shared/stackblitz/index.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,4 +6,4 @@
66
* found in the LICENSE file at https://angular.dev/license
77
*/
88

9-
export * from './stack-blitz-button';
9+
export * from './stackblitz-button';

docs/src/app/shared/stack-blitz/stack-blitz-button.ts renamed to docs/src/app/shared/stackblitz/stackblitz-button.ts

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-11,15 +11,15 @@ import {ExampleData} from '@angular/components-examples';
1111
import {MatIconButton} from '@angular/material/button';
1212
import {MatIcon} from '@angular/material/icon';
1313
import {MatTooltip} from '@angular/material/tooltip';
14-
import {StackBlitzWriter} from './stack-blitz-writer';
14+
import {StackBlitzWriter} from './stackblitz-writer';
1515
import {MatSnackBar} from '@angular/material/snack-bar';
1616

1717
@Component({
18-
selector: 'stack-blitz-button',
19-
templateUrl: './stack-blitz-button.html',
18+
selector: 'stackblitz-button',
19+
templateUrl: './stackblitz-button.html',
2020
imports: [MatIconButton, MatTooltip, MatIcon],
2121
})
22-
export class StackBlitzButton {
22+
export class StackblitzButton {
2323
private _stackBlitzWriter = inject(StackBlitzWriter);
2424
private _ngZone = inject(NgZone);
2525
private _snackBar = inject(MatSnackBar);

docs/src/app/shared/stack-blitz/stack-blitz-writer.spec.ts renamed to docs/src/app/shared/stackblitz/stackblitz-writer.spec.ts

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1,21 +1,21 @@
11
import {HttpClientTestingModule, HttpTestingController} from '@angular/common/http/testing';
22
import {fakeAsync, flushMicrotasks, TestBed} from '@angular/core/testing';
33
import {EXAMPLE_COMPONENTS, ExampleData, LiveExample} from '@angular/components-examples';
4-
import {StackBlitzWriter, TEMPLATE_FILES} from './stack-blitz-writer';
4+
import {StackBlitzWriter, TEMPLATE_FILES} from './stackblitz-writer';
55
import stackblitz from '@stackblitz/sdk';
66

77
const testExampleId = 'my-test-example-id';
88
const testExampleBasePath = `/docs-content/examples-source/cdk/my-comp/${testExampleId}`;
99

1010
const FAKE_DOCS: {[key: string]: string} = {
11-
'/assets/stack-blitz/src/index.html': '<material-docs-example></material-docs-example>',
12-
'/assets/stack-blitz/src/main.ts': `import {MaterialDocsExample} from './material-docs-example';`,
11+
'/assets/stackblitz/src/index.html': '<material-docs-example></material-docs-example>',
12+
'/assets/stackblitz/src/main.ts': `import {MaterialDocsExample} from './material-docs-example';`,
1313
[`${testExampleBasePath}/test.ts`]: 'ExampleComponent',
1414
[`${testExampleBasePath}/test.html`]: `<example></example>`,
1515
[`${testExampleBasePath}/src/detail.ts`]: 'DetailComponent',
1616
};
1717

18-
const TEST_URLS = TEMPLATE_FILES.map(filePath => `/assets/stack-blitz/${filePath}`).concat([
18+
const TEST_URLS = TEMPLATE_FILES.map(filePath => `/assets/stackblitz/${filePath}`).concat([
1919
`${testExampleBasePath}/test.ts`,
2020
`${testExampleBasePath}/test.html`,
2121
`${testExampleBasePath}/src/detail.ts`,

docs/src/app/shared/stack-blitz/stack-blitz-writer.ts renamed to docs/src/app/shared/stackblitz/stackblitz-writer.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-28,7 +28,7 @@ const COPYRIGHT = `Copyright ${new Date().getFullYear()} Google LLC. All Rights
2828
*/
2929
const DOCS_CONTENT_PATH = '/docs-content/examples-source';
3030

31-
const TEMPLATE_PATH = '/assets/stack-blitz/';
31+
const TEMPLATE_PATH = '/assets/stackblitz/';
3232

3333
/**
3434
* List of boilerplate files for an example StackBlitz.

0 commit comments

Comments
 (0)